Pay-Per-Click (PPC) is a form of online advertising where businesses pay only when someone clicks on their advertisement.
The most popular PPC platform is Google Ads, where businesses can appear at the top of search results almost instantly.
PPC includes:
Unlike SEO, PPC generates traffic immediately after launching a campaign.

SEO continues generating traffic even after your optimization work is completed.
A well-ranked page can bring visitors for years without paying for every click.
Users generally trust organic search results more than advertisements.
Ranking naturally on Google increases credibility.
Although SEO requires time and effort, it often delivers a better long-term ROI than paid advertising.
Publishing valuable content helps establish your business as an industry expert.
Blogs, guides, and informative pages improve customer trust.
Unlike PPC, organic traffic doesn't require payment for every visitor.
Over time, SEO becomes one of the most affordable customer acquisition strategies.

Neither is universally better. SEO is ideal for long-term growth, while PPC is best for immediate visibility and lead generation.
Yes. Google Ads allows businesses to set daily budgets, making PPC accessible to companies of all sizes.
SEO usually takes several months to produce significant results, depending on your industry, competition, and website condition.
Not necessarily. Combining SEO and PPC often provides the best overall performance by maximizing visibility across search results.
SEO generally offers better long-term ROI, while PPC provides faster returns when campaigns are properly optimized.
